We are a private credit firm specializing in secured, asset-backed lending, including real estate–backed financing. We’re seeking a Real Estate Closing Agent with strong underwriting instincts to support transactions from application review through closing, funding, and post-close. This role blends risk assessment, documentation, title/lien review, and closing coordination to ensure files are accurate, compliant, and audit-ready.
Responsibilities
- Evaluate loan applicants’ creditworthiness and assess risk for real estate–backed loans
- Review financial documents (tax returns, bank statements, financial statements) to determine eligibility, terms, and conditions
- Coordinate real estate closings from clear-to-close through funding and post-close file completion
- Communicate underwriting requirements, closing conditions, and decisions to clients and internal stakeholders
- Collaborate with title companies, attorneys, notaries, and third parties to meet closing timelines
- Review title commitments/policies, lien searches, payoff statements, surveys (as applicable), and resolve exceptions/curative items
- Confirm lien position, validate legal/vesting/entity details, and ensure enforceable documentation
- Prepare and maintain accurate closing packages, underwriting files, reports, and audit-ready records
- Ensure adherence to company policies, compliance requirements, and documentation standards
- Reconcile accounts and prepare statements related to loan funding and closing transactions
- Perform quality assurance checks to ensure consistency, accuracy, and completeness across files and systems
